A Brief History of Margaret River Wine
The story of Margaret River’s wine begins in the late 1960s when Dr Tom Cullity planted the first vineyard, Vasse Felix. Since then, the region has grown into a powerhouse of premium wines, known for its Mediterranean climate, which is perfect for producing rich Cabernet Sauvignon and crisp Chardonnay. With over 200 wineries, Margaret River offers a diverse array of wine styles and experiences, making it an ideal destination for both novices and aficionados.
Our List of The Best Wineries in the Margaret River Region
In no particular order:
- Vasse Felix
As the first vineyard in Margaret River, Vasse Felix holds a special place in the region’s history. Established in 1967, it specialises in rich Cabernet Sauvignon and premium Chardonnay. The picturesque setting, complete with a restaurant offering delightful meals paired with their wines, makes it a perfect starting point for your Margaret River journey.
- Leeuwin Estate
Known for its stunning Art Series wine labels that feature works by renowned Australian artists, Leeuwin Estate combines art and wine in a unique way. You can enjoy tastings paired with seasonal dishes at their restaurant overlooking lush meadows. Plus, if you’re feeling adventurous, you can even take a scenic flight to the estate!
- Voyager Estate
Voyager Estate is an elegant winery with a focus on showcasing its history through exceptional wine experiences. You can taste directly from the barrel and explore Australia’s largest underground barrel cellar. Their six-course, wine-paired lunch is an exquisite way to savour the best of their offerings.
- Howard Park
With its modern architecture designed according to feng shui principles, Howard Park is as impressive to look at as it is to taste. The Burch family, members of Australia’s First Families of Wine, oversee this winery, which is known for its high-quality Riesling. Enjoy a specialised flight tasting of their iconic wines for a truly memorable experience.
- Wills Domain
A standout for both wine and cuisine, Wills Domain is where culinary artistry meets award-winning wines. The restaurant features a refined industrial feel and focuses on sustainable, wild-harvested produce. Indulge in their decadent four-course tasting menu, perfectly paired with their premium wines, for a dining experience that’s second to none.
- Brown Hill Estate
Family-owned and operated since 1995, Brown Hill Estate offers a personalised touch. Take a private walk with winemaker Nathan Bailey through the vineyard, learning about the winemaking process firsthand. After a tasting in the Barrel Hall, you’ll leave with a complimentary bottle of their Reserve Red or Reserve Chardonnay, adding a special keepsake to your visit.
- Cullen Wines
A pioneer of biodynamic practices in the region, Cullen Wines offers a unique perspective on sustainable winemaking. Located on a stunning estate, visitors can enjoy tastings while overlooking the vineyards. Their commitment to organic practices results in wines that are both vibrant and true to the land.
- Petersons Wines
This family-run winery is known for its warm hospitality and focus on small-batch winemaking. Petersons offer a range of wines, from bold reds to refreshing whites, and their cellar door is a cozy spot to sample a flight. They often host events, making it a lively place to connect with other wine lovers.
- Ashbrook Estate
Ashbrook Estate is a hidden gem known for its beautiful garden setting and quality wines. With a focus on small production, their wines often reflect the unique terroir of Margaret River. The intimate tasting experience allows you to enjoy their wines while learning about the estate’s dedication to craftsmanship.
What Else Can You Experience?
While wine is the star attraction, Margaret River also boasts stunning landscapes, pristine beaches, and incredible wildlife. You can explore the breathtaking Margaret River coastline, perfect for swimming, surfing, and soaking in the sun. For those who love the outdoors, the Leeuwin-Naturaliste National Park offers beautiful walking trails and opportunities for whale watching.
The region is also famous for its culinary delights. From farm-to-table restaurants to gourmet food producers, there’s something to satisfy every palate. Pairing local produce with the fantastic wines of the region is an experience you won’t want to miss.
